Grass Leaved Goldenrod

General Information

Grass Leaved Goldenrod is a perennial plant. It will be a taller plant, reaching 4 feet in height. This plant is native to a broad swath of the northern and eastern US. The leaves will be longer and narrow in form. It will keep a nice deep green color through the growing seasons. Grass Leaved Goldenrod will have flat topped clusters of bright yellow flowers. They will typically be in bloom from mid to late summer. These flowers are very attractive to butterflies and many other pollinators. Great choice for native planting areas, spreads freely under ideal conditions.

Additional Information

Solidago graminifolia will be 3 to 4 feet tall, with a width of 18 to 24 inches. It is recommended for USDA climate zones 3 to 9. Grass Leaved Goldenrod can grow in full to part sunlight conditions. It will do best with average to moderate amounts of moisture in well drained soils.
